Transaction 21e0f3e30d52201deeb6a7b5ca6cecb90bc73e9dd7383d8a917b251c2193ba4a
1 Input
2 Outputs
- 21e0f3e30d52201deeb6a7b5ca6cecb90bc73e9dd7383d8a917b251c2193ba4a:0
- 21e0f3e30d52201deeb6a7b5ca6cecb90bc73e9dd7383d8a917b251c2193ba4a:1
value 2430000
address 18jiN35HYLG5kwNMAuJLK1dsTzJ8mqCrs9
value 30590555
address 3GfspTC9hPYT5V9QtHsMR1EUfqesq6iFPA